1、包含头文件 你需要包含math.h头文件,这个头文件中包含了所有数学函数的定义。 #include <math.h> 2、使用反三角函数 math.h提供了三种反三角函数: asin(x):返回x的反正弦值,其中x的范围是[1,1]。 acos(x):返回x的反余弦值,其中x的范围是[1,1]。 atan(x):返回x的反正切值,其中x
在C语言中,反三角函数(也称为逆三角函数)通常通过数学库函数来实现。这些函数定义在math.h头文件中。以下是常用的几个反三角函数及其使用方法: 反正弦函数 (asin): 计算一个数的反正弦值(以弧度为单位)。 #include <stdio.h> #include <math.h> int main() { double x = 0.5; // 要计算反正弦的数值...
然后一般常用的sin(x)cos(x)tan(x)其中的x必须要以弧度为单位。如果以“度”为单位,比如说求30度的正弦值,要用sin(x*180/3.1415926)的形式arcsin(x)arccos(x)arctan(x)arccot(x)以上四个则是相应的反三角函数,函数值的单位也是弧度。若要求arctan(1)的度数,要用以下的形式: arctan(1...
1、反三角函数是一种基本初等函数。2、它是反正弦arcsin x,反余弦arccos x,反正切arctan x,反余切arccot x,反正割arcsec x,反余割arccsc x这些函数的统称,各自表示其反正弦、反余弦、反正切、反余切 ,反正割,反余割为x的角。3、它并不能狭义的理解为三角函数的反函数,是个多值函数。4...
反三角函数可以用来解决与三角函数相关的实际问题,例如求解角度、计算边长等。 二、查表法的原理 查表法是一种实现反三角函数的常用方法,其基本原理是通过查找预先制作好的表格,来获取反三角函数的值。这些表格通常以角度为横坐标,对应的三角函数值为纵坐标。因此,当我们需要求解一个三角函数的逆值时,只需在表格中...
C/C++反三角函数使用注意 最近写的东西用到了数学库中的acos函数,但是代码在运行的时候有时候会出莫名其妙的错误,比如返回值是个特别大的数。 最后在debug 的时候发现acos返回的数据很奇怪,但是传入的参数明明没有问题,可以保证是(-1,1)。 回想起,double类型的末尾数据是不确定的,比如当double类型数据alpha = ...
反三角函数 得到的是弧度,除 圆周率乘 180 就得 度数。如果要算很多个 反三角函数,你可以 建一个系数 r2d.弧度 乘 r2d 得角度。例如:include <stdio.h> include <math.h> int main(){ double x,y;double pi=asin(1.0)*2.0;double r2d=180.0/pi;int i;for (i=0;i<5;i++){...
表示反三角函数,比如sin30°=0.5,那么arcsin0.5 = 30°,同样,tan45° =1 ,那么arctan1 = 45°,具体请百度百科 "反三角函数",对其定义域 与 值域 均有详细说明,. HDMI 1.4 中有定义 ARC, HEC 功能, 1.3 以后就有可选的CEC功能定义.ARC: 声音回复传,可以利用制HtplugPin和百NC Pin 传输声音信号 HEC...
1、C语言中,数学函数是函数的一种。指专门进行数学运算的函数,一般都在<math.h>头文件下。如果该标准库内存在某个函数的反函数,直接调用该反函数即可计算。2、数学函数列表:1)int abs(int i); 求整数的绝对值。2)long labs(long n); 求长整型数的绝对值。3)double fabs(double x); ...
反正切函数:θ = arctan(a/b)反余切函数:θ = arccot(b/a)反正割函数:θ = arcsec(c/b)反余割函数:θ = arccsc(c/a) 根据反三角函数的定义:1. 反正弦函数:若 sinθ = a/c,则θ = arcsin(a/c),定义域为 [-1, 1],值域 [-π/2, π/2]。2. 反余弦函数:若 cosθ = b/c,则θ ...